Output c590f4d24698b8fc817f50e0d808b9390d855b573b08124bd6a0d7d4c898075d:1

value
16583337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ec6f13d92a823b6d70045cabf0a32ff7232ecd7 OP_EQUAL
address
3PTZ4xPvgaSJvupVQdseBkmBQ29i2k17JR
transaction
c590f4d24698b8fc817f50e0d808b9390d855b573b08124bd6a0d7d4c898075d
spent
true